    Wide throat nozzles increase productivity by 15%

    The Wide throat nozzle improves on the long venturi style nozzle. It is intended to increase productivity by approximately 15% over smaller throat nozzles. These nozzles are frequently employed in high-pressure applications. A carbide nozzle is another name for this type of nozzle.


    They have a large diverging exit bore, allowing for more air volume and a larger pattern. They are intended to propel media over longer distances and at higher pressures.

Hexagonal Boron Nitride (hBN) nozzles

Hexagonal Boron Nitride (hBN) nozzles are machinable ceramics made by sintering boron nitride powder/flake into a solid. They have good electrical insulation, low reactivity, and are resistant to heat. These materials are used in a wide range of applications, such as plasma arc insulation, low friction seals, and prototype parts.


The mechanical properties of hBN grains are highly dependent on the boron atom morphology. The morphology of hBN grains changed from quasi-spherical to flake-dominated as the boron content increased.
